Overview

Dimitris Vlassopoulos is affiliated with the Foundation for Research and Technology Hellas in Greece. The research focuses primarily on materials science and chemical engineering, with notable contributions to the study of polymers, fluid dynamics, and related chemical and biomedical fields.
